Principal Advisor, Gender and Entrepreneurship (Ghana and UK)
Em Ekong has over 25 years of experience as a business advisor and project manager, with a recent focus on the development and delivery of enterprise, employment, and skills programs in both the UK and West Africa. Fifteen years ago, Em founded Urban Inclusion Community Ltd, a regeneration company and social enterprise dedicated to developing and delivering programs that support women, young people, and ethnic minority communities.
Em’s areas of expertise include business mentoring, business planning, raising finance, fundraising, business growth strategies, project evaluation and monitoring, community capacity building, marketing/communications, and project management.
Through Urban Inclusion, Em played a key role in establishing the African and Caribbean Business Experience, in partnership with RegenFirst, which organized the largest business-to-business event during London’s 2012 Olympics. This event successfully brought together African, Caribbean, and Diaspora businesses to support the development of enterprise and economic growth through sector-specific business matching and knowledge transfer.
In 2011, Em expanded Urban Inclusion’s reach by establishing offices in Ghana, where the organization provided business development services and economic development consultancy to isolated and disadvantaged entrepreneurs in West Africa.
At the core of Em’s work is building entrepreneurial ecosystems in Africa. His current initiatives include collaboration with the Aspen Institute of Development Entrepreneurs, Women’s Entrepreneurship and Leadership for Africa, ShEquity (investing in women entrepreneurs), GIZ/Scale Up Africa (supporting Member-Based Business Organisations), and Sound Diplomacy, where he works on developing business resilience strategies for MSMEs and organizations operating in the music, creative, and cultural sectors.
